Output 574dfffc52ae4934b8b9fc093df0a3e43d18d3699435f52aa6b48f024202505a:0

value
4171359
script pubkey
OP_0 OP_PUSHBYTES_32 d2a8ec1d77e8cf09ac7ae81070561597ddfc2c4b51fafa60a5d6fc3a091622f8
address
bc1q625wc8thar8sntr6aqg8q4s4jlwlctzt28a05c996m7r5zgkytuqyen2a8
transaction
574dfffc52ae4934b8b9fc093df0a3e43d18d3699435f52aa6b48f024202505a
spent
true